Start your trip in the vibrant city of Atlanta. In the morning, visit the Atlanta Botanical Garden, a serene oasis featuring stunning plant collections. In the afternoon, explore the Martin Luther King Jr. National Historic Site and learn about the civil rights movement. As the evening sets in, head to the Ponce City Market, a bustling food hall and shopping destination housed in a converted historic building.
Travel to the enchanting city of Savannah. In the morning, take a leisurely stroll through Forsyth Park, known for its beautiful fountain and lush greenery. In the afternoon, explore the historic district and admire the well-preserved architecture. As the evening sets in, enjoy a scenic riverboat cruise along the Savannah River, taking in the sunset views.
Head to the charming town of Helen, known for its Bavarian-inspired architecture. In the morning, explore Anna Ruby Falls, a picturesque waterfall nestled in the Chattahoochee-Oconee National Forest. In the afternoon, visit the Alpine village of Helen and enjoy the unique shops and restaurants. As the evening sets in, relax by the Chattahoochee River and savor a delicious German meal.
Make your way to Tybee Island, a charming barrier island near Savannah. In the morning, relax on the pristine beaches and soak up the sun. In the afternoon, visit the Tybee Island Light Station and Museum for panoramic views of the coast. As the evening sets in, indulge in fresh seafood at one of the island's waterfront restaurants.
Explore the rich history of Macon, a city filled with beautiful architecture and cultural landmarks. In the morning, visit the Hay House, an elegant antebellum mansion. In the afternoon, explore the Ocmulgee National Monument, showcasing Native American history and stunning ancient mounds. As the evening sets in, enjoy live music at one of the vibrant downtown venues.
